I got sent this product for free because I'm a bzzagent. I would never have tried this product otherwise because I find most ciders too sharp and don't like the ordinary lambrini. I was very pleasently suprised, its very fruity and not as sharp as most ciders or as sickly as normal lambrini. This is one of the fruitiest ciders I have tasted and I would go so far as to say I wouldn't object to drinking this again.

As part of the current BzzAgent Lambrini Cider campaign I was given a coupon to purchase a product from their range. The campaign urged me to try it with my 'girl friends' but I tried it with my 'boy friends' - a much tougher crowd to impress with Lambrini I'm sure you'll agree. We served it with ice and everyone agreed that the light fruity taste was perfect for summer, however whilst sweet it wasn't sugary or syrupy which was a major plus. The drink has a light fizz although we all felt it could almost do with being a bit more fizzy. I believe the drink is 4% alcohol but it isn't a strong taste - I would be wary of how much I was drinking as it does really remind me of Schloer and it would be easy to drink a lot and forget you were consuming alcohol. We found the bottles easily in the supermarket although the packaging isn't that distinctive. All in all - easily worth the £3 odd it costs.
